Skin – la piel
(Pronounced pee-el)
To remember that skin is pronounced pee-el (piel) in Spanish, use the following mnemonic:
Her skin got so hot in the sun it was beginning to peel (piel).

Piel is feminine, so it’s la piel. Imagine a lady peeling off her own skin:

Examples of piel (skin) in a sentence
Ella tiene una piel muy suave y delicada.
(She has very soft and delicate skin.)
El sol puede dañar tu piel si no usas protector solar.
(The sun can damage your skin if you don't use sunscreen.)
Mi piel se pone roja cuando hace mucho frío.
(My skin turns red when it is very cold.)
